Danny and Baez team up with Waylon Gates (played by Lyle Lovett), a Texas Ranger hunting the "Lone Star Killer". Reviewers praised the "Texas vs. New York" banter, with Lyle Lovett’s "homespun Texas wisdom" serving as a great foil for Danny Reagan’s sarcasm.
Critics and viewers alike noted the episode's successful balance of three distinct storylines:
Erin and Anthony clash over a case involving a citizen who shot two people in what he claimed was self-defense. This adds a moral complexity to the episode, especially as it pits Erin against the personal opinions of Mayor Chase. Community Feedback
